Step-by-Step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the ground beef, minced garlic, grated ginger, chopped green onions, egg, breadcrumbs, soy sauce, sesame oil, gochujang, brown sugar, and rice vinegar. Season with salt and black pepper and mix.
- Shape the meat mixture into 1-inch meatballs and place them on the baking sheet, spacing them apart.
- Bake the meatballs for 18–20 minutes, or until fully cooked and golden brown, reaching an internal temperature of 160°F (71°C).
- While the meatballs bake, prepare the spicy mayo dip by whisking together the mayonnaise, gochujang, lime juice, and honey until smooth.
- Once baked, cool the meatballs for a few minutes before serving. Garnish with sesame seeds and scallions, and enjoy!
